PAUL DANIELS and Debbie McGee will compere the Rotary Club of Henley Bridge’s annual fashion show at Phyllis Court Club on March 17.

The magician and his wife, who live in Willow Lane, Wargrave, were asked by Ben Lambourne, a friend who joined the club last year.

The pair will perform a routine at the start and end of the show.

McGee said: “We always have little routines that we can do so we will have a talk about it a couple of days beforehand and decide what’s right for the room.

“I’m definitely the more fashionable of the two of us. Paul isn’t really into clothes unless there’s a magic trick in them!”
